Bowlers’ Day At Denaby.

Denaby 76 for 7    Wath 69

Wath’s low score at Denaby on Saturday would have been even lower had it not been for several fielding blunder by Denaby. As it was Wath were all out before 4-30. The wicket was against fast bowling, and Sam Kennedy was unable to get a wicket. Hargreaves did his best to stop the destructive progress of the other Denaby bowlers till J. Palmer made an excellent catch when the ball was travelling well for the boundary.

Luther Robinson had the best bowling return with 3 for 7. Greenwood took 3 for 18.

Denaby appeared to have an easy thing on with only 70 to get and plenty of time before them, but Hargreaves got to work and their first 6 wickets fell for 34. L. Palmer pulled things round a bit and was batting well when he played into the hands of the watchful Pearce. Hargreaves’s return was 5 for 43. Freddy Pearce did not get any wickets but ‘ fielded well.
